米麩能改善糖尿病老鼠餐後血糖反應

Dietary Rice Bran Improves the Glycemic Response in Rats with Streptozotocin-induced Diabetes

摘要


本研究的主要目的在探討富含膳食纖維的米麩飲食對streptozotocin(STZ)誘導的糖尿病老鼠其血糖;血脂及對股病變之影響。將40隻雄性Wistar老鼠(平均300克)隨機分成兩組,一半利用STZ誘導成糖尿病老鼠。再將STZ誘導的糖尿病老鼠及無糖尿病老鼠隨機分成兩組,分別餵與AIN 76正常老鼠飼料配方飲食及米麩飲食(20 g/100 g diet)。餵食四週後,不論是餵AIN 76飲食或米麩飲食之糖尿病鼠皆有高血糖,但米麩飲食組明顯降低其血中果糖胺值(和其基準值比),且和AIN 76飲食組比有較低的葡萄糖耐量試驗面積。AIN 76飲食之糖尿病鼠組血中總膽固醇濃度明顯升高(和其基準值比),但米麩組並沒有變化。糖尿病鼠在AIN 76飲食組及米麩飲食組皆有明顯高肌酸酐值及蛋白尿。依數據顯示:米麩飲食能有效降低血中果糖胺值及減緩葡萄糖耐量試驗之血糖反應面積,但並未觀察到有延緩糖尿病腎病變之情形。

並列摘要


A 2 x 2 factorial experimental design was employed to evaluate the effect of a fiber-rich rice bran diet on blood glucose, lipid and diabetic nephropathy in streptozotocin (STZ)-induced diabetic rats. Forty ale adult Wistar rats were randomly divided into four groups, two of which were injected with nicotinamide and STZ to induce diabetes. Both normal and STZ-diabetic rats were fed AIN-76 diets and rice bran diets (20 g/100 g diet). After 4 weeks of feeding, STZ-diabetic rats both with and without rice bran were significantly (p < 0. 05) hyperglycemic. Blood fructosamine was ameliorated in rice bran diet-fed STZ-diabetic rats, compared with the baseline. STZ-diabetic rats fed a rice bran diet had a significantly lower blood glucose response than those fed the diet without rice bran. Blood totota1 cholesterol was higher than baseline in AIN-76 diet-fed STZ-diabetic rats, but it had not changed in rice bran diet-fed STZ-diabetic rats. In STZ-diabetic rats, blood creatinine and proteinuria were significantly higher than in nondiabetic rats. These results suggest that a rice bran diet is effective in lowering blood fructosamine and improving the glucose response, but it cannot retard the development of diabetic nephropathy in STZ-diabetic rats.
